Abstract

The utility model provides a cooking utensil, which comprises a cooker body and a cover body; the inner pot is arranged in the pot body; the cover body is arranged on the cooker body in an openable and closable manner, when the cover body covers the cooker body, a cooking space is formed between the cover body and the inner pot, and the cover body comprises a surface cover and a heat insulation plate; the face cover includes a receiving hole; the insulation board is arranged on the lower side of the face cover and comprises a protruding part, and the protruding part extends through the receiving hole; wherein the face cover further comprises a buckle, the protruding part is provided with a mounting hole, and the heat insulation plate extends through the mounting hole through the buckle to be fixed to the face cover. The cover 100 of the cooking appliance according to the present invention will be described in detail with reference to fig. 1 to 6.
As shown in fig. 1 to 3, the cover body 100 mainly includes a face cover 110, an insulation board 120 disposed on a lower side of the face cover 110, and a panel (not shown) disposed on an upper side of the face cover 110. The face cover 110 is formed of a resin material through an injection molding process. The insulation board 120 is made of a metal material. The face cover 110 includes a receiving hole 111. The receiving hole 111 is a through hole. The insulation board 120 correspondingly includes a protrusion 123, the protrusion 123 extending through the receiving hole 111.
In this embodiment, the face cover 110 further includes a latch 112, the protrusion 123 has a mounting hole 124, and the mounting hole 124 is a through hole. The thermal insulation plate 120 is mounted to the face cover 110 by the snaps 112 extending through the mounting holes 124. Therefore, the assembly process of the cover body 100 is simple, the assembly efficiency can be improved, and the production cost can be reduced.
It should be noted that, in the present invention, the directional terms "upper" and "lower" are those determined based on the cooking appliance which is placed upright and the lid body 100 is in the closed state.
As shown in fig. 3, the insulation board 120 mainly includes an insulation board main body 121 and a flange 122 extending upward from a peripheral edge of the insulation board main body 121, and a protrusion 123 is provided on an upper surface of the flange 122. The heat insulation plate 120 includes a plurality of protrusions 123, and the plurality of protrusions 123 are disposed on an upper surface of the flange 122 at intervals. The number and position of the catches 112 and the number and position of the projections 123 may correspond, respectively.
The projection 123 may include a straight wall portion 125 extending in a vertical direction, and the mounting hole 124 is provided on the straight wall portion 125. As shown in fig. 5, the catch 112 may include a first inclined surface 113 at the side, the first inclined surface 113 extending through the mounting hole 124 and abutting against a straight wall 125. The first inclined surface 113 is configured to be inclined toward the mounting hole 124 in a direction from below to above.
Considering the mold stripping of the face cover 110, etc., in order to cooperate with a specific structure on the face cover 110, as shown in fig. 3 and 6, some of the projections 123 may further include an inclined portion 126 connected to the straight wall portion 125, the inclined portion 126 being disposed at an upper side of the mounting hole 124 and configured to extend inwardly from the straight wall portion 125. Specifically, the inclined portion 126 is configured to be inclined in a downward direction toward the catch 112.
As shown in fig. 5 and 6, the catch 112 may include a second inclined surface 114 at the top, the second inclined surface 114 extending through the mounting hole 124 and abutting against a straight wall portion 125 (see fig. 5) or an inclined portion 126 (see fig. 6). Specifically, the second inclined surface 114 is configured to be inclined downward in a direction toward the projection 123 to facilitate insertion of the catch 112 into the mounting hole 124.
As shown in fig. 4, the face cover 110 may further include a supporting portion 115, and a lower surface of the supporting portion 115 abuts against an upper surface of the insulation board 120 for supporting the insulation board 120. The support portion 115 and the catch 112 are oppositely disposed at both sides of the protrusion 123, and specifically, the support portion 115 and the catch 112 are oppositely disposed at both sides of the mounting hole 124. One side of the support portion 115 abuts against the projection 123 to be able to abut the projection 123 against the catch 112. Specifically, the support portion 115 has a third inclined surface 116 at the side, and the upper end of the third inclined surface 116 abuts to the projection 123. The third inclined surface 116 may be configured to be inclined toward the protrusion 123 in an upward direction to serve as a fitting guide for facilitating the passage of the clip 112 through the mounting hole 124. The cooperation of the first inclined surface 113, the second inclined surface 114, and the third inclined surface 116 with the protrusion 123 can control the tightness of the vertical assembly of the insulation board 120.
As shown in fig. 3 and 4, the insulation board main body 121 may be provided with a temperature measuring hole 127 for installing a temperature measuring component (not shown), and the temperature measuring hole 127 is a through hole. The face cover 110 includes a steam valve portion 117, and the steam valve portion 117 has a steam passage that can communicate with the outside atmosphere. The heat insulation plate main body 121 has an arc shape corresponding to the steam valve portion of the face cover 110. In addition, the insulation board main body 121 may further include a reinforcement portion 128 adjacent to the flange 122, so that the insulation board 120 has high strength. The reinforcing portion 128 is configured to protrude upward and extend along the circumferential direction of the insulation board main body 121. In one embodiment, not shown, the reinforcement 128 is configured to be downwardly concave. The reinforcement 128 may be stamped and formed.
